首页>>帮助中心>>VPS服务器容器资源监控告警

VPS服务器容器资源监控告警

2025/10/25 13次
在云原生技术普及的今天,高效管理VPS服务器上的容器资源已成为运维核心挑战。当容器化应用规模扩大时,资源使用波动可能导致服务中断或性能下降。本文将系统解析如何通过动态监控与智能告警体系,实现容器资源的可视化管控,帮助您主动防范资源耗尽风险,提升服务稳定性与运维效率。

构建VPS服务器容器资源实时监控与精准告警系统


容器监控的底层架构与数据采集原理


在VPS服务器环境中部署容器监控体系,需打通数据采集通道。主流的容器编排平台(如Kubernetes/Docker Swarm)通过暴露Metrics API接口,实时输出CPU占用率、内存消耗、网络吞吐量及磁盘IOPS等关键指标。采集代理(如Prometheus Exporters)会以15-30秒为周期抓取cAdvisor(容器监控工具)或kubelet(Kubernetes节点代理)的原始数据。值得注意的是,单容器资源限额(cgroups)的监控精度直接影响告警有效性——当某个容器进程突发PID暴增或内存泄漏时,精确到进程组的资源隔离数据能快速定位故障源。您是否在数据采集阶段就建立了容器级别的资源视图?


核心监控指标的多维度阈值设定策略


告警系统的灵敏性取决于阈值的科学性设置。针对VPS服务器容器场景,需建立四层动态指标模型:基础资源层(CPU利用率>85%持续5分钟)、应用性能层(容器HTTP请求延迟>500ms)、容量预警层(容器根文件系统使用率>90%)以及异常模式层(单容器网络丢包率突增300%)。对于内存监控需特殊处理:当容器内存使用量触及limits限制值时会触发OOM Killer(内存溢出终止机制),因此建议设置两条水位线——持续80%使用率告警提醒,瞬时95%使用率则自动触发弹性伸缩。这种分层阈值设计如何帮助您避免误报?


告警规则引擎的智能过滤机制设计


单纯的阈值告警易产生噪音干扰。优秀的VPS容器监控系统需引入告警抑制(Alert Inhibition)和静默规则(Silencing Rules)。当宿主机发生网络故障时,自动抑制该节点所有容器的资源告警;或在计划性维护窗口,按Service标签批量静默关联容器。更高级的场景是建立关联分析规则:若某微服务(microservices)的10个副本容器同时出现CPU飙升,则合并为单个服务级告警而非10条独立报警。您是否经历过告警风暴?这些机制可降低70%以上的无效告警量。


可视化监控看板与根因定位技术


告警触发后的根因分析依赖可视化能力。通过Grafana等工具构建的容器监控看板,应聚合展现三类关键视图:全局热力图(显示所有容器CPU/内存压力分布)、关联拓扑图(呈现服务间调用链路与资源依赖)以及历史基线对比(自动标记资源使用的异常偏差)。当收到"容器内存使用超限"告警时,运维人员可立即调取该容器的内存增量TOP 5进程(PID限流策略)及关联容器的资源水位,快速判断属于内存泄漏还是合理扩容需求。这种立体化视图如何提升故障定位速度?


告警系统集成与自动化响应流程


告警信息需精准触达责任人。主流的VPS容器监控栈(如Prometheus+Alertmanager)支持告警路由(Routing)策略:开发测试环境的容器告警仅发送至Slack频道,生产环境的核心服务则通过企业微信/飞书/短信等多级推送,并自动按值班表@对应SRE工程师。在高级运维场景中,可设置自动化剧本(Playbook)——当检测到容器因OOM反复重启时,自动执行内存dump收集并横向扩容副本数;当存储卷容量告警时联动触发CSI卷扩容接口。这些自动化操作是否能减少您的应急响应时长?


资源优化与成本控制的长效治理


持续分析监控历史数据可驱动资源优化。通过机器学习算法识别容器资源使用的周期性规律,能动态调整requests/limits配置,典型场景如电商容器在促销时段的弹性配置策略。对于长期低负载容器(如CPU利用率<15%持续7天),自动触发资源缩容建议;对频繁触发limit限制的容器,则生成垂直扩容工单。据统计,科学的容器资源配比可使VPS服务器资源利用率提升40%,同时避免过度配置造成的成本浪费。您的监控数据是否已用于容量规划?


构建完整的VPS服务器容器资源监控告警体系,本质上是在稳定性与成本效益间寻求最优解。从数据采集精度到多级告警规则,再到可视化根因分析,每个环节都直接影响微服务架构的运维质量。当您将动态阈值与智能压制策略结合自动化响应,不仅能规避资源枯竭导致的服务中断,更能通过历史数据优化资源配置,实现容器环境的长效治理与弹性管控。毕竟在云原生时代,看不见的资源消耗才是最昂贵的运维成本。

版权声明

    声明:本站所有文章,如无特殊说明或标注,均为本站原创发布。任何个人或组织,在未征得本站同意时,禁止复制、盗用、采集、发布本站内容到任何网站、书籍等各类媒体平台。如若本站内容侵犯了原著者的合法权益,可联系我们996811936@qq.com进行处理。